Check out the latest news from Firebase at Cloud Next 2025.
Learn more.
允許特定網址模式
透過集合功能整理內容
你可以依據偏好儲存及分類內容。
為避免未經授權的使用者利用您的 API 金鑰,建立從您的網域重新導向至不屬於您網站的 Dynamic Links,您應指定 Dynamic Links 可重新導向的網址。
如要指定允許的網址,請在 Firebase 控制台的 Dynamic Links 頁面中,依序點選 more_vert >「將網址模式加入許可清單」,然後使用 RE2 語法指定最多 10 個規則運算式。只有符合其中一個規則運算式的網址,才能成功用於 Dynamic Links 的深層連結 (link
) 或備用連結 (afl
、ifl
、ipfl
、ofl
)。如果您指定網址模式,任何不符合其中一個模式的網址都會導致 Dynamic Links 傳回 HTTP 錯誤 400。
您應盡可能限制網址模式。例如:
過於寬鬆 |
較好 |
^https://.*.com/.*$
可重新導向至任何網站上結尾為 .com 的任何網頁。
|
^https://mybrand\.com/.*$
只能重新導向至 mybrand.com 的網頁。
|
^https://play.google.com/.*$
可重新導向至任何應用程式的 Google Play Store 頁面。
|
^https://play\.google\.com/.*id=myapp\.com$
只能將使用者重新導向至套件名稱為 myapp.com 的應用程式 Google Play Store 頁面。
|
^https://itunes.apple.com/.*$
可重新導向至 itunes.apple.com 上的任何網頁。
|
^https://itunes\.apple\.com/.*id123$
只能將使用者重新導向至 ID 為 id123 的應用程式 App Store 頁面。
|
您可以查看 Dynamic Links 的偵錯頁面,並確認沒有警告,確保 Dynamic Links 的深層連結和備用連結符合其中一個網址模式:
https://example.page.link/WXYZ?d=1
除非另有註明,否則本頁面中的內容是採用創用 CC 姓名標示 4.0 授權,程式碼範例則為阿帕契 2.0 授權。詳情請參閱《Google Developers 網站政策》。Java 是 Oracle 和/或其關聯企業的註冊商標。
上次更新時間:2025-04-15 (世界標準時間)。
[[["容易理解","easyToUnderstand","thumb-up"],["確實解決了我的問題","solvedMyProblem","thumb-up"],["其他","otherUp","thumb-up"]],[["缺少我需要的資訊","missingTheInformationINeed","thumb-down"],["過於複雜/步驟過多","tooComplicatedTooManySteps","thumb-down"],["過時","outOfDate","thumb-down"],["翻譯問題","translationIssue","thumb-down"],["示例/程式碼問題","samplesCodeIssue","thumb-down"],["其他","otherDown","thumb-down"]],["上次更新時間:2025-04-15 (世界標準時間)。"],[],[]]